Output 3d66590d444cab2535d49bea40c6303fbf59d7d89a19bcee02f61140d32bc521:1

value
11923048
script pubkey
OP_0 OP_PUSHBYTES_20 17ac58396b84ec09a4cf87d1368f91f79c6e01bc
address
ltc1qz7k9swttsnkqnfx0slgndru377wxuqdurqzvl7
transaction
3d66590d444cab2535d49bea40c6303fbf59d7d89a19bcee02f61140d32bc521
spent
true